HEU-2025-Improved reliability and optimised operations and maintenance for wind energy systems
About
Our project will deliver a first-of-its-kind, fully integrated “digital twin” ecosystem for both onshore and offshore wind farms, combining physics-informed machine learning, autonomous inspection robotics, and blockchain-backed data management to push reliability and operations & maintenance (O&M) beyond today’s state of the art. By focusing on critical sub-systems (e.g. dynamic cables, mooring lines, power electronics) and deploying advanced condition monitoring, predictive analytics and autonomous tools, AURORA project will reduce downtime , cut O&M costs, and extend asset lifetime of assets.
